As the closing of the transfer window approaches, Orlando City SC finds itself in an interesting position. The Lions have shown flashes of brilliance this season, yet they face challenges that may require adjustments to their squad. The club's management is evaluating specific areas of the team that need reinforcement.
Defense has been a recurring topic in recent discussions. Although players like A. Gomez have shown solidity, injuries have forced the team to rely more on their backups. Reinforcements in the backline could provide the security Orlando City SC needs to compete against high-level teams in the league.
On the other hand, the forward line has also been less dynamic. While M. Ojeda and Gustavo Caraballo Delgado have contributed significantly, there is room for a new striker to bring competition and energy. Some rumors suggest the management is looking towards the international market for talent that can adapt quickly to the team's dynamics.
The atmosphere among fans is one of anticipation. Some supporters are skeptical about the need for a change, while others are eager to see new faces on the pitch. Can Orlando City SC find the perfect balance between stability and new additions before the window closes? Only time will tell.
